BookPeople is a beloved two-story independent bookstore in Austin, Texas, offering a vast, well-curated selection of fiction, nonfiction, children's, YA, and local Texana titles. Known for its friendly, knowledgeable staff who provide personalized recommendations, it features quirky gifts, cards, toys, and exclusive merch. With an on-site CoffeePeople café serving coffee, snacks, and vegan/gluten-free options, plus regular author events and book clubs, it's a cozy, vibrant destination where visitors can linger for hours. Centrally located at 603 N Lamar Blvd, it embodies Austin's unique culture and is a must-visit for book lovers.

Extensive selection of new and curated books across genres, including fiction, nonfiction, children's, YA, and local Texana titles.
Personalized book suggestions and assistance from friendly, well-read staff, including in-store displays and recommendation cards.
On-site café offering coffee, tea, breakfast tacos, sandwiches, pastries, and vegan/gluten-free snacks for a cozy reading experience.
Unique gifts, cards, puzzles, toys, socks, and exclusive BookPeople/Austin-themed merch like totes, shirts, and mugs.
Regular author signings, lectures, book clubs, and special events to foster community and literary engagement.
Large, dedicated area for kids' books and activities, making it family-friendly and ideal for young readers.
